This project will rehabilitate the 21st Street North bridge over I-66. The bridge was originally built in 1980.

The project includes:

  • Resurfacing the concrete bridge deck and closing deck joints
  • Repairing concrete piers and abutments
  • Replacing bearings

The width of the existing lanes and sidewalks on the bridge will remain the same.

The bridge carries about 1,400 vehicles a day.

Estimated Costs
Preliminary Engineering - $610,000
Construction - $4 million
Total - $4.6 million

This project is financed with federal and state funding, including State of Good Repair funds used for bridges.

Benefits 

This project will improve safety for drivers and pedestrians and extend the overall life of the bridge.

Major Milestones 

Virtual Public Information Meeting - June 2022
Advertise for Construction - March 2023
Begin Construction - Mid-2023
